09:05 — We enabled zstd compression on telemetry payloads from the Bellvane agent fleet to cut bandwidth costs. Payload sizes dropped 70%, as projected. However, the older Thornfield collectors could not negotiate the new encoding and silently dropped batches, which is why dashboards went dark for the eastern fleet between 09:05 and 09:52. For new team members: collectors advertise supported encodings at handshake; always check that list before changing agent defaults. The rollback was cut from the build referenced below.

build token for yajof-bajof: htk31_506ff1188f74596b5bb2eec94edc43c

Minutes — Management Meeting, Quorvale Ltd

Churn in the Fernhollow pilot hit 14% last month — higher than anyone liked. Sita walked through exit surveys: onboarding confusion is the main culprit, not pricing. Agreed actions: simplified setup flow by month-end, and a win-back offer for lapsed accounts. For the incoming director, the confidential note on next steps follows below.

board note of tawip-hahip: Only 7 of the 80 pilot accounts renewed Ralath, so a churn review is set for April 1.

## Profiling GPU memory with Vramlens

Heads up for the security review: Vramlens attaches via the Corvid driver shim, so it needs elevated perms only during capture, never at rest. Captures are scrubbed of tensor contents — we keep allocation sizes and timestamps only. Profiles land in the Mossbank sandbox bucket with a 7-day TTL. Each capture embeds the shim build it ran under, shown here.

session token of tajef-bageg = htk21_5d90d574934f3ccae6437